diff options
| -rw-r--r-- | abs/core/archlinux-keyring/PKGBUILD | 16 | ||||
| -rw-r--r-- | abs/core/archlinux-keyring/archlinux-keyring.install | 11 | 
2 files changed, 21 insertions, 6 deletions
diff --git a/abs/core/archlinux-keyring/PKGBUILD b/abs/core/archlinux-keyring/PKGBUILD index b0ff4f6..bca238a 100644 --- a/abs/core/archlinux-keyring/PKGBUILD +++ b/abs/core/archlinux-keyring/PKGBUILD @@ -1,18 +1,22 @@ -# $Id: PKGBUILD 162172 2012-06-22 16:21:47Z pierre $ +# $Id$  # Maintainer: Pierre Schmitz <pierre@archlinux.de>  pkgname=archlinux-keyring -pkgver=20120622 +pkgver=20150605  pkgrel=1  pkgdesc='Arch Linux PGP keyring'  arch=('any')  url='https://projects.archlinux.org/archlinux-keyring.git/'  license=('GPL')  install="${pkgname}.install" -source=("ftp://ftp.archlinux.org/other/${pkgname}/${pkgname}-${pkgver}.tar.gz" -        "ftp://ftp.archlinux.org/other/${pkgname}/${pkgname}-${pkgver}.tar.gz.sig") -md5sums=('8fecc7ec4a9b51e3166b79a90930e7ce' -         'afa0253f24c6ba3fee22ae6c2150cb6c') +source=("https://sources.archlinux.org/other/${pkgname}/${pkgname}-${pkgver}.tar.gz" +        "https://sources.archlinux.org/other/${pkgname}/${pkgname}-${pkgver}.tar.gz.sig") +md5sums=('65f1c23ca17e8c72363d831a352e6fd2' +         'SKIP') +validpgpkeys=( +              '4AA4767BBC9C4B1D18AE28B77F2D434B9741E8AC' # Pierre +              'A314827C4E4250A204CE6E13284FC34C8E4B1A25' # Thomas +             )  package() {  	cd "${srcdir}/${pkgname}-${pkgver}" diff --git a/abs/core/archlinux-keyring/archlinux-keyring.install b/abs/core/archlinux-keyring/archlinux-keyring.install index 81726c6..19f594b 100644 --- a/abs/core/archlinux-keyring/archlinux-keyring.install +++ b/abs/core/archlinux-keyring/archlinux-keyring.install @@ -1,6 +1,17 @@  post_upgrade() {  	if usr/bin/pacman-key -l >/dev/null 2>&1; then  		usr/bin/pacman-key --populate archlinux + +		# Re-enable key of dwallace +		# See https://bugs.archlinux.org/task/35478 +		if [ -z "$2" ] || [ "$2" = "20130525-1" ]; then +			printf 'enable\nquit\n' | LANG=C \ +				gpg --homedir /etc/pacman.d/gnupg \ +				--no-permission-warning --command-fd 0 \ +				--quiet --batch --edit-key \ +				5559BC1A32B8F76B3FCCD9555FA5E5544F010D48 \ +				2>/dev/null +		fi  	fi  }  | 
